Liam Gallagher has criticised a Scottish council for suggesting Oasis fans were "drunk, middle-aged and fat".
William John Paul Gallagher is an English singer and songwriter. He is the lead singer and co-founder of the rock band Oasis and fronted the rock band Beady Eye from 2010 to 2014, before starting a successful solo career in 2017. One of the most recognisable figures in British rock music, Gallagher is noted for his distinctive vocal style and outspoken personality.
